Efektivita zjednodušené četby při výuce slovní zásoby: Kombinace dvou přístupů / The Efficiency of Graded Readers for Teaching Vocabulary: A Combination of Two Approaches

Sedláček, Martin January 2018 (has links)
The diploma thesis deals with the relationship between graded readers and teaching vocabulary. We examine whether extensive reading leads to vocabulary acquisition on the basis of context provided by graded readers. In addition, we focus on the frequency of occurrence of individual lexical items and we interpret it as an important variable in teaching lexis. These two factors are compared using test data from two groups of experiment participants. The first group (the reading group) was asked to read the text at their own pace, while the second group was asked to read the text while listening to it being narrated by an English native speaker. Based on hitherto research, the listening group is expected to outperform the reading group. After introducing the topic in chapter 1, we attempt to define extensive reading in chapter 2. Graded readers are based on providing sufficient amount of context for understanding unknown vocabulary. In this chapter we contrast practical application of extensive reading with theoretical foundation in secondary literature. Chapter 3 delineates the methodology used in the present thesis. It is based on replicating a study by Waring and Takaki (2003), and also on research into audio- assisted reading. This methodology is used to measure the efficiency of reading and...

Netermické ztráty kožního krytu na Klinice popáleninové medicíny za roky 1998 - 2008 / Non-termic skin losses at the Prague Burn Centre through the years 1998 -2008

Pintar, David January 2010 (has links)
Exfoliative loses of the skin are rare, but potentially lethal disorders that includes toxical epidermal necrolysis and staphylococcal scalded skin syndrome. They should be considered in a differential diagnosis and a quick transfer to the burn center is essential. The level of care and the effectiveness of the treatment at the burn unit significantly decreases the morbidity and mortality of these diseases. A transport of the patient proceeds with a time delay and the usage of the systemic corticosteroids at the previous hospital unit is frequent, according to the results of our clinical study. TEN patients are often unsuccesfully treated at the different units, mostly at the dermatological clinics and the infection diseases clinics, where the treatment of the involved skin surface is insufficient and corticosteroids are often administered. This evidence indicates that there is a requisiteness of an wider education intended for the medical public, especially for the medical members who may have a greater probability of encountering TEN patients.

Detecção de chuveiros atmosféricos iniciados por hádrons massivos / Detection of extensive air showers initiated by massive hadrons

Washington Rodrigues de Carvalho Junior 06 August 2008 (has links)
Nesta tese investigamos uma possível componente de partículas previstas por modelos além do modelo padrão da física de partículas, como por exemplo o massive gluino LSP, nos raios cósmicos de altíssimas energias (UHECR). Nosso objetivo é determinar os sinais experimentais em telescópios de fluorescência devidos a hádrons exóticos massivos e neutros, genericamente denominados de UHECRons. Para simular chuveiros iniciados por essa classe de partículas, alteramos o pacote Aires de simulação de chuveiros atmosféricos e o modelo hadrônico Sibyll. Estes chuveiros foram utilizados como entrada em simulações de telescópios de fluorescência por nós desenvolvidas, obtendo-se assim as distribuições dos observáveis desses chuveiros exóticos. A partir da comparação entre as características de chuveiros iniciados uhecrons e prótons, desenvolvemos métodos para a separação de sinais entre esses dois tipos de partículas. Esses métodos podem ser utilizados em uma análise inicial, com o intuito de procurar por sinais de partículas exóticas nos dados reais de observatórios de UHECR. / In this thesis we investigate a possible component of particles predicted by models beyond the standard model of particle physics, like the massive gluino LSP, in the ultra high energy cosmic rays (UHECR). Our objective is to determine the experimental signals on fluorescence telescopes due to exotic massive and neutral hadrons, generically called UHECRons. To simulate showers initiated by this class of particle, we altered the shower simulation package Aires and the hadronic model Sibyll. These showers were used as input in our simulations of fluorescence telescopes, thus obtaining the distribuitons of the observables for these exotic showers. By comparing the characteristics of showers initiated by uhecrons and protons, we developed methods to distinguish the signals between these two particles. These methods can be used in an initial analysis in order to look for signals of exotic particles in the real data of UHECR observatories.

Extensive Reading and Grammatical Development : A Case Study within SLA

Johansson, Emma January 2014 (has links)
This is a case study focusing on the effects of extensive reading. The study mainly deals with grammatical development and the relationship between input and output, but it also discusses learning strategies. The study aimed to answer the following question: To what extent, and in what ways, does extensive reading affect output and grammatical performance? The essay analyses the grammatical performance of a Spanish speaking PhD student in chemistry, whose main exposure to English was scientific literature during the study period. Accuracy tests were used in combination with free writing. The study did not find any direct, unquestionable relationship between extensive reading and grammatical development. Instead it shows the difficulty of separating input and output. However, the study indicates that output may be an effective tool for improving grammatical performance and that some focus on form may be necessary, at least for the grammatical development of adults. Furthermore, the study indicates that teaching may influence grammatical performance and, therefore, the presentation of grammar needs to be carefully considered.

Comparison of Authentic and Simplified Texts : A case study of Wuthering Heights

Öhqvist, Åsa January 2016 (has links)
The aim of this essay is to explore in what way Graded Readers are different from authentic texts against the background of English as a Second Language (ESL) and the use of authentic and simplified text in ESL teaching. The material used for this purpose is the authentic text of Wuthering Heights by Emily Brontë and two upper-intermediate Graded Readers from two different publishers. The study uses the software readability-score and manual analysis to examine the texts with regards to lexical choice, language structure and story. The study showed that the Graded Readers are simplified in all aspects studied. Moreover, the Graded Readers differ from each other as well, most notably in the style of the text due to sentence structure and story simplification. This could imply that different authors of Graded Readers adopt different styles when simplifying text and that the grading levels are not comparable between different publishers. / <p>Engelska</p>

Functional analysis of CyclinD2;1-type genes expressed in transgenic banana plants

Talengera, David 29 May 2012 (has links)
Early maturity is one of the most important aerial growth traits next to bunch size, in determining banana productivity. However, low seed fertility in banana and the lack of breeding lines limit the application of conventional breeding for this trait. Genetic transformation with a CyclinD2-type gene, responsible for the CyclinD2 protein sub unit, which modulates the cell cycle progression at the G1/S phase, enhanced growth of tobacco plants. On this basis, investigations were carried out on the possibility of increasing the growth rate of banana plants through transformation with and expression of a CyclinD2- type coding sequence. Arabidopsis thaliana;CyclinD2;1 (Arath;CycD2;1) gene and its banana ortholog were over-expressed in banana to test their growth enhancement potential. The banana CyclinD2;1 (Musac;CycD2;1) was isolated from an East African highland cooking banana (AAA) cultivar “Nakasabira” and a cDNA was created by PCR using degenerated primers which was followed by genome walking. Characterization of the banana cyclin protein revealed an IWKVHAHY motif that was found to be conserved across the Musaceae family. Phylogenic analysis revealed a higher protein sequence identity of this banana cyclin to CyclinD2;1 of monocot plants than that of Arabidopsis. This cyclin was also found to be expressed highly in meristematic tissue which linked it to the cell cycle. The coding sequence was submitted to the GeneBank under accession number HQ839770. Arabidopsis and banana CyclinD2;1 gene coding sequences under the control of a constitutive promoter were used to transform embryogenic cells of the banana cultivar “Sukalindiizi” (AAB) using the Agrobacterium transformation system. A higher relative expression of Arath;CyclinD2;1 was found in the shoot than in the root apices and expression reduced transcript amounts of the endogenous banana CyclinD2;1. Plants of transformed banana line D2-41 had the highest Arath;CyclinD2;1 transcript amount and exhibited a significantly faster leaf elongation rate, better root growth, faster first leaf opening and a bigger lamina composed of bigger epidermal cells than non-transformed control plants. Banana plants transformed with Musac;CyclinD2;1 had a higher transcript amount of the transgene in the root apices when compared to the shoot apices. The higher transcript amount in the roots of plants of transformed line NKS-30 was related to faster root growth and development of an extensive root system. Overall, this study has provided evidence that expression of cyclin coding sequences in transformed banana is related to growth promotion. Specifically, Arath;CyclinD2;1 promoted shoot growth while the Musa homolog promoted root growth. Shoot and root growth phenotypes obtained in this study might have the potential to improve banana productivity in terms of short plant growth cycle, increased bunch weight, improved plant anchorage and increased plant resistance to root nematode damage. Future work should assess the produced plants in the field to allow transformed plants to exhibit their full potential and to be able to fully evaluate the vegetative and flowering phases. / Thesis (PhD)--University of Pretoria, 2012. / Plant Science / unrestricted

A metamorfose de jovens lideranças que querem ser professoras: como a escuta analítica propicia a potência crítica da práxis. / The metamorphosis of young leaders who want to become teachers: how the analitical listening propitiates to critical potency of the praxis.

Tatiana Karinya Carpigiani Rodrigues 11 April 2008 (has links)
No presente trabalho pretendi investigar como se deu a constituição da identidade de três jovens lideranças da comunidade da favela do Real Parque/Jardim Panorama, levando em consideração os momentos de metamorfose que cada uma delas sofreu ao longo deste processo. A fim de compreender a complexidade dos aspectos envolvidos na constituição de suas identidades como futuras docentes, recorri a autores da Psicologia, Filosofia, Sociologia e História que permitissem ampliar meu olhar psicanalítico a respeito do objeto estudado. Existia nessas jovens algo de muito peculiar que contribuiu para o processo de constituição da identidade docente - uma consciência crítica aguçada. O encontro com alguns educadores, que lhes propiciou o desenvolvimento de um pensamento crítico, permitiu-lhes um olhar questionador em relação à realidade educacional encontrada nos estágios realizados em escolas municipais, por exigência de sua formação acadêmica. Por ocasião da presente pesquisa, ofereci a elas um espaço de escuta analítica, ancorada em uma concepção dialética da relação entre psique e mundo, que lhes permitisse questionar alguns aspectos relacionados à constituição da identidade docente, a ponto de metamorfosearem-se politicamente dando lugar a uma práxis transformadora, promovendo, nesse sentido, uma verdadeira educação emancipatória. Finalmente, terminei este trabalho com a descrição da revelação da práxis dessas jovens, que se deu em meio à liderança que exerceram espontaneamente junto à comunidade do Real Parque, impedindo a desapropriação de parte da favela em que moram, ocorrida no final de 2007. / In this present work, I intended to do a research on how the identity of three young leaders of Real Parque/Jardim Panorama shantytown was constituted, and also taking into consideration the changing that each one of them suffered along the process of investigation. In order to understand the complexity of the aspects involved in the constitution of their identities as future teachers, I looked for authors of Psychology, Philosophy, Sociology and History that allowed me to expand my psychoanalytic vision concerning the object of study. There was something very special with these youngsters that contributed to the process of constitution of their teaching identity - a critical sharpened consciousness. The meeting with some educators, which provided them a critical analysis, allowed them to question the real educational system found in municipal schools due to probations required in academic graduation. At the time of this research, I offered them a space of analytical listening, based on a dialectical concept of the connection between psyche and the world, which could allow them to question some aspects related to the constitution of the teaching identity, that was about to metamorphose them politically, giving place to a changing praxis and promoting, in this sense, a real emancipate education. Finally, I finished this work with the description of the disclosure of the praxis of these youngsters, which happened within their spontaneous leadership taken over inside Real Parque community, avoiding the dispossession of part of the slum where they live in the end of 2007.

Sportovní centrum / The sports centre

Moravec, Jakub January 2018 (has links)
This final thesis is a project of sports center in Brno Líšeň. This building has two floors and it is without basement. Building has irregularly-shaped floor plan. Main entrance is to ground floor. Hall with reception has no celling and it is opened up to celling of second floor. There is dominating flush facade in hall. Entrance to sanitary facilities and gym is from hall, next entrance from here is to wellness and office. Gym has higher celling height than others. This part forms ground part of building. There is staircase to second floor in the hall. In second floor there are some rooms for group physical excercising with lector. In second floor are next sanitary facilities Entrance to terrace is through gallery in second floor. Struktural system is created of sand lime blocks KM Beta. Sports center is roofed with flat roof, part of this is extensive green roof.
